## Description

Mindy Crouch, LICSW, is a licensed Clinical Social Worker and the founder of Pando Geriatric Counseling, P.C. With a background in social work and a passion for helping families dealing with dementia, Mindy offers a range of resources and books aimed at educating individuals about the disease. Mindy's approach is modern, interactive, and straightforward, using journaling, drawing, and games to foster a deeper understanding of emotions and experiences related to dementia. Her goal is to assist the elderly in aging with grace and dignity, drawing on her personal experiences watching her grandparents navigate dementia. Mindy's books are designed to empower individuals to recognize and share their emotions, ultimately enhancing their ability to support loved ones facing dementia.
